A sacred mound is returned to a Native American tribe


Listen Later

In coastal Louisiana, an Indigenous tribe received their land back-- a sacred mound in Grand Bayou Indian Village, an hour South of New Orleans. But what does a Native American tribe do when their history is at risk of being washed away by climate change? Health Equity Reporter Drew Hawkins and Environmental Justice Reporter Danny McArthur teamed up for this double feature.
